The Buzz | Packer sells Sydney mansion for Aussie record

Casino billionaire James Packer sold his Sydney harborside mansion for a reported A$60 million (USD44 million), a new record in Australia’s biggest city.
The six-level La Mer property in the suburb of Vaucluse owned by Packer and his former wife sold in the past week for a record price for any home in Australia, the Daily Telegraph reported yesterday, without giving the source of the sale price. Fairfax Media reported it sold for A$70 million to Australian-Chinese billionaire businessman Chau Chak Wing. Surging home prices in the nation’s biggest cities following the central bank’s two interest-rate cuts this year to a record-low 2 percent have sparked fears of a property bubble
